Is your washing machine shaking violently during the spin cycle? This is a common problem with a few simple solutions. The most likely culprit is an uneven installation. Make sure your machine is perfectly level. Use a spirit level to check, and adjust the feet until the machine sits squarely on the floor. This will significantly reduce vibrations and prevent the machine from “walking” across the floor.
Uneven laundry distribution is another major factor. Overloading the machine, or having a heavily unbalanced load (like a single large item like a bathmat) will cause excessive shaking. Try to distribute clothes more evenly, and avoid overloading. Consider using the machine’s wash cycles at a lower spin speed to reduce the impact of imbalance, especially if your machine is already a bit older.
Beyond leveling and load balance, consider these additional points: Is your washing machine placed on a solid, level surface? A soft or uneven floor can amplify vibrations. Are the shock absorbers still functioning correctly? Over time, these can wear out, leading to increased shaking. If you’ve checked the above and the problem persists, it’s advisable to consult a qualified appliance repair technician to check for internal issues, like motor problems or bearing wear.
Pro Tip: Regularly inspect your washing machine’s feet for wear and tear. If the feet are damaged, replace them promptly.

What should I do if my washing machine shakes?
Shaky Washing Machine? Don’t Panic! A vibrating washing machine is a common problem, often solved simply by reducing the load size or redistributing the clothes for a more balanced wash. Overloading is a major culprit; uneven weight distribution causes imbalance and excessive shaking.
Beyond the Basics: Identifying Deeper Issues However, persistent shaking might indicate a more serious mechanical problem. Worn-out shock absorbers or drum bearings are frequent offenders. These components absorb vibrations during the spin cycle, and their deterioration leads to increased machine movement. A faulty tachometer, which monitors the drum’s speed, can also contribute to instability, as the machine may struggle to compensate for speed variations.
Preventative Measures: Prolonging Your Machine’s Life Regular maintenance is key to preventing these problems. Check the leveling of your machine – an uneven surface exacerbates vibrations. Avoid overloading, and try to distribute heavier items evenly throughout the load. Consider using a washing machine mat to enhance stability and reduce vibrations transferred to the floor.
Troubleshooting and Repair: When to Call a Professional If adjustments to the load or leveling don’t resolve the issue, it’s time to investigate the machine’s internal components. Examining the shock absorbers and bearings requires technical expertise and often calls for professional assistance. Replacing these parts usually requires specialized tools and knowledge.
Why is my new washing machine jumping?
A brand new washing machine jumping around? The most likely culprit is the presence of shipping bolts. These are crucial fasteners that secure the drum during transportation, preventing damage from movement and impact.
Failure to remove them before the first wash is a common mistake, leading to excessive vibration and potentially serious damage to the machine.
Here’s what you need to know:
- Location: Shipping bolts are usually found at the rear of the machine. Consult your washing machine’s manual for their exact location and removal instructions.
- Number: The number of bolts varies depending on the model. Expect anywhere from 2 to 4, sometimes more.
- Removal: Use the appropriate tools (usually a socket wrench) to carefully remove the bolts. Keep the bolts and any associated washers; you might need them for future transportation.
- Holes: After removing the bolts, you’ll likely have holes where the bolts were. These are usually covered by plastic caps supplied with the machine. These caps should be inserted to prevent water ingress and to maintain the machine’s aesthetics.
- Leveling: Once the bolts are removed and the caps are in place, ensure your washing machine is correctly leveled. Uneven flooring can exacerbate vibrations.
Beyond shipping bolts, other causes of excessive vibration include:
- Unbalanced load: Distribute laundry evenly in the drum.
- Faulty installation: Ensure the machine is sitting on a level and stable surface.
- Internal mechanical issues: If the problem persists after removing the shipping bolts and checking the installation, contact a qualified technician. This could indicate a more serious problem requiring professional attention.

Why is my washing machine shaking so much during the spin cycle?
Is your washing machine shaking violently during the spin cycle? This isn’t just annoying; it can damage your appliance and even your floor. A common culprit is an overloaded drum. Stuffing the machine too full throws off the balance, leading to intense vibrations. Remember to check the manufacturer’s recommended load size – it’s usually printed inside the door or in your manual.
Another frequent issue is improper installation. A machine that isn’t level will wobble and shake. Ensure your washing machine sits perfectly flat on a stable, solid surface, using the adjustable feet to correct any unevenness. A slightly uneven floor can also contribute to this problem; consider placing a leveling mat under the machine for added stability.
Uneven weight distribution within the drum is another key factor in spin-cycle shaking. Try to distribute heavier items evenly throughout the load, avoiding clumping. Consider separating heavier items (like jeans) from lighter ones (like t-shirts) for better balance.
Beyond these common causes, internal problems like worn-out shock absorbers or suspension springs can cause excessive shaking. These components dampen vibrations, and their failure allows the machine to shake more intensely. If you’ve checked the above and the problem persists, it’s time to consult a qualified appliance repair technician.
Finally, consider the type of washing machine you own. Top-loading machines are generally more prone to vibration issues due to their design. Front-loading machines tend to be quieter and less prone to excessive shaking if properly installed and balanced.

How can I determine if my washing machine’s springs are faulty?
Unstable or off-vertical drum movement during a wash cycle is a key indicator of a faulty washing machine spring. The drum should spin smoothly and evenly; any deviation suggests a compromised spring. This instability can manifest as excessive vibration, loud noises, or even the machine moving across the floor. Beyond these obvious signs, consider less visible clues. A broken or weakened spring might cause the machine to lean noticeably to one side, even when not in operation. Regularly inspect the springs for signs of rust, corrosion, or visible damage like cracks or bends. These visual checks are crucial for preventative maintenance. Note that a single faulty spring can affect the entire suspension system, leading to uneven weight distribution and ultimately, more significant damage to the machine. Ignoring these signs can lead to accelerated wear and tear on other components and even potential safety hazards.

How do I fix a washing machine that shakes violently?
A violently shaking washing machine? The most common culprit is unbalanced laundry. Overloading or a load clumped to one side prevents even rotation, leading to violent shaking and loud banging. Redistributing clothes within the drum is the first step. However, if the shaking persists after redistributing the laundry, other issues might be at play.
Beyond unbalanced loads, consider these possibilities:
Transportation Bolts: These secure the drum during shipping. Failing to remove them before the first use is a guaranteed recipe for a shaking machine and potential damage. Check your machine’s manual for their location – they are typically found on the back or at the bottom of the machine.
Leveling: An unlevel machine is another frequent offender. Use a level to ensure the machine sits perfectly flat on the floor. Adjust the feet as needed for a stable base. Even a slight tilt can dramatically increase vibration.
Worn Shock Absorbers or Springs: These components cushion the drum’s movement. Over time, they can wear down, leading to increased vibration. This typically requires professional repair, as replacing these parts demands specific expertise.
Faulty Motor Mounts: These secure the motor to the machine’s chassis. If damaged or loose, excessive vibration can result. Similar to shock absorbers, repairing this requires professional help.
Drum Issues: Although less frequent, a damaged or bent drum can cause imbalance and excessive shaking. This usually necessitates a professional assessment and potentially a drum replacement.
If simple adjustments don’t solve the problem, professional inspection and repair are recommended to prevent further damage to your washing machine.

Why does my washing machine jump during the spin cycle?
Excessive vibration and movement during the spin cycle are common complaints with washing machines. The most frequent culprit is improper installation. Uneven placement is the key factor. Your washing machine needs a perfectly level and stable surface. Any bumps, slopes, or unevenness will cause the machine’s springs to distribute weight unevenly, leading to excessive vibration and potentially movement.
Beyond the obvious, here are some less obvious factors to check:
- Check the floor: Ensure your floor is structurally sound. Soft or uneven flooring can amplify vibrations.
- Leveling feet: Adjust the leveling feet to ensure the machine is perfectly level. Use a spirit level to verify. Even a slight tilt can cause significant issues.
- Transportation bolts: Always remove the shipping bolts. These are designed to secure the machine during transport, but leaving them in place will severely restrict movement and cause intense vibration.
- Load imbalance: An unevenly distributed load can cause significant imbalance, leading to jumping. Try redistributing items before starting the spin cycle.
- Machine’s age and condition: Older machines or those with worn-out components (e.g., worn-out shock absorbers or damaged bearings) are more prone to vibration issues. Consider professional maintenance.
If the problem persists after checking these points:
- Consult your user manual: It often contains specific troubleshooting advice.
- Contact a qualified appliance repair technician: They can diagnose more complex issues, such as motor problems or bearing wear, and perform necessary repairs.
